沙漠中的魚

          欲上天堂,先下地獄
          posts - 0, comments - 56, trackbacks - 0, articles - 119
            BlogJava :: 首頁 ::  :: 聯系 :: 聚合  :: 管理

          網上看到Jtable中revalidate的說法

          Posted on 2009-05-02 01:18 沙漠中的魚 閱讀(578) 評論(0)  編輯  收藏 所屬分類: Java

          問題:在找資料的時候看見JTabel用了setModel方法后會加上一個revalidate方法,
          可我刪了這個方法并沒見有什么不同,請指點!

          回答一:如果在application上有哪個component由于事件的觸發而發生變化(比如,形狀)的話,這個方法就是用來更新當前程序的界面用的,就相當于重畫一下界面

          回答二:The original author comments, very clear:


          I added a revalidate to JTable in the case that the table structure
          changes (columns/rows added/removed). This is necessary, since such an
          operation changes the size parameters of the JTable. It makes JTable
          behave more nicely in JScrollPane in an app I have here.
          主站蜘蛛池模板: 青田县| 翁牛特旗| 盐津县| 漳平市| 宣城市| 正蓝旗| 普陀区| 定襄县| 额敏县| 无锡市| 宣化县| 麦盖提县| 廉江市| 温泉县| 化州市| 观塘区| 澄迈县| 昭苏县| 永丰县| 上林县| 博罗县| 商南县| 汾西县| 科技| 岫岩| 通辽市| 建平县| 中阳县| 汾阳市| 马尔康县| 潢川县| 牡丹江市| 延边| 万年县| 布尔津县| 璧山县| 化隆| 象山县| 新竹县| 辰溪县| 家居|